Hey — handover before I'm out next week.

The Tillbrook converter still shows one-cent drift on multi-leg conversions; it rounds per leg instead of at the end. Fix is merged behind the `sumfirst` flag but not enabled yet. Support will see refund tickets until then — point them at the known-issues page. If you need to toggle the flag, the config vault is sealed; its recovery passphrase is right below.

recovery phrase for fawif-tajeg: norael-aldmir-casir-brivan-ulaion

# Break-Glass Access — PoolMarshal Connection Pooler

This page documents emergency access for future maintainers of PoolMarshal, the database connection pooling layer used by the Ardenfell cluster. Break-glass should only be used when the pooler refuses all admin connections and normal credential rotation has failed. First drain active pools via the sidecar socket, then launch the break-glass shell. The shell will demand operator confirmation before granting superuser scope. Enter the recovery passphrase recorded just below.

recovery phrase for fajeg-hagug: holox-fenmir

Changelog v4.2 — Ledgerlens audit-log viewer. The setting AUDITLOG_TOKEN was renamed to LENS_READER_TOKEN to match the new reader-scoped permission model; the old name is ignored as of this release and logs a deprecation warning. Release manager: update every environment file in the Harwick and Dunmere stacks before rollout, as the viewer fails closed without it. In each .env, remove the old entry and add the renamed credential on the next line.

vault entry, yahif-yajep: COURIER_KEY29=b802bdf8034096b65a51c6ba5abe2